Model Analytics & Market Report
We've analyzed more than 191,800 sales records of this model and here are some numbers.
The average price for new (MSRP) 2021 TOYOTA HIGHLANDER in 2021 was $41,405.
The average price for used 2021 TOYOTA HIGHLANDER nowadays in 2024 is $35,508 which is 86% from the original price.
Estimated mileage driven per year is 11,461 miles.

Frequently asked questions
Odometer issues such as rollbacks or malfunctions raise red flags about potential fraud or misuse in the 2021 TOYOTA vehicle’s history, if such problems are recorded.
Remanufactured status, if detailed, includes major overhauls and replacements, offering a new lease on life for the 2021 TOYOTA, but with considerations for its past use.
The parts content information on a window sticker shows the percentage of vehicle components sourced from specific countries, important for consumers interested in the origin of their vehicle's parts.
Vehicles that have been flooded may have a specific flood title or watermark in the vehicle history report, indicating significant water damage, if such events are documented.
You can use a Monroney label to compare different 2021 TOYOTA models by reviewing their features, fuel economy, safety equipment, and pricing directly on the sticker.
Our reports may include information on any past recalls issued for 2021 TOYOTA vehicles, detailing the nature of the recall and whether it was addressed, if data is available.
Sales descriptions may provide detailed narratives of the 2021 TOYOTA vehicle’s features and condition at the time of each sale, highlighting potential changes and upgrades, depending on available data.
Safety ratings, if available, provide information from crash tests and safety evaluations, which can help assess the 2021 TOYOTA vehicle's protection level in accidents.
